LivePortrait 표현 스왑 노트북 — 무료 Colab, InsightFace 대신 MediaPipe 사용, MIT 라이선스
요약
이 기술 기사는 LivePortrait를 활용하여 표정 복제(Expression Swap) 기능을 구현한 Colab 노트북을 소개합니다. 이 노트북은 단일 얼굴과 임의의 표정을 포함하는 소스 이미지와, 표정이 변경되어야 하는 타겟 이미지를 입력받아 신분을 유지하면서 표정을 전달할 수 있습니다. 특히, 기존 LivePortrait가 사용하던 InsightFace 대신 MediaPipe를 사용하여 전체 파이프라인을 MIT 및 Apache 2.0 라이선스로 구성함으로써 상업적 활용성을 높였습니다. 이 노트북은 무료 Colab T4 GPU 환경에서 실행 가능하며, 슬라이더 조절을 통해 표정 및 머리 회전 블렌딩 기능을 제공합니다.
핵심 포인트
- LivePortrait 기반의 표정 복제(Expression Swap) 기능 구현
- InsightFace 대신 MediaPipe를 사용하여 라이선스 문제를 해결하고 상업적 활용성을 확보함 (MIT + Apache 2.0)
- 무료 Colab T4 GPU 환경에서 실행 가능한 데모 노트북 제공
- 슬라이더 인터페이스를 통해 표정 및 머리 회전 블렌딩을 직관적으로 제어 가능
- Android 앱 Face2FaceAI의 기술적 기반이 되는 데모 프로젝트임
저는 LivePortrait 를 사용하여 표정 복제 기능을 수행하는 Colab 노트북을 구축했습니다. 단일 얼굴과 임의의 표정을 포함하는 소스 이미지를 로드하고, 표정이 변경되어야 하는 단일 얼굴을 포함하는 타겟 이미지를 로드한 후, 블렌드 슬라이더를 조정하면 신분을 유지하면서 표정을 전달합니다.
이 노트북은 LivePortrait 에서 얼굴 감지를 위해 사용하는 InsightFace 를 MediaPipe 로 대체하여 전체 파이프라인이 상업적으로 허용 가능한 라이선스 (MIT + Apache 2.0) 를 따릅니다. 무료 Colab T4 GPU 에서 실행됩니다.
기능: 슬라이더로 조절 가능한 표정 블렌드와 머리 회전 블렌드, 512×512 업샘플링 출력.
이것은 저의 Android 앱 Face2FaceAI 의 데모입니다. 이 앱은 기기에서 실행되며 얼굴 재삽입, 비대칭 보정, 템플릿 표정 및 기타 기능을 추가합니다. 더 많은 정보는 face2faceai.com 에서 확인하세요.
예시는 얼굴 재삽입 (앱 기능) 을 포함한 전/후 표현 스왑을 보여줍니다.
피드백 환영합니다. 이는 저의 첫 번째 공개 릴리스입니다.
AI 자동 생성 콘텐츠
본 콘텐츠는 r/StableDiffusion의 원문을 AI가 자동으로 요약·번역·분석한 것입니다. 원 저작권은 원저작자에게 있으며, 정확한 내용은 반드시 원문을 확인해 주세요.
원문 바로가기